Recognizing Visible Damage on Your Roof
One of the primary indications that it's time to contact a
commercial roofing contractor is visible damage. Damages can manifest in various forms, such as leaks, sagging areas, cracked flashing, or visible holes. These issues often start small but can quickly grow into larger structural concerns if left unaddressed. For example, even a minor leak can seep into insulation, causing energy inefficiency and higher utility bills, or create conditions for mold growth inside the building. The expertise of a professional ensures that the damage is thoroughly assessed and repaired, preventing further deterioration and protecting your property investment.
Knowing When Your Roof Has Reached Its Lifespan
Another critical reason to hire a commercial roofing contractor is when your roof has reached the end of its expected lifespan. According to RubyHome, depending on the type of roof and material quality, an average roof lasts between 25 and 50 years. However, factors such as climate, maintenance history, and installation quality can significantly impact this timeline. If your roof is nearing these age milestones, a professional contractor can conduct a comprehensive inspection to determine its remaining durability and performance. Proactive replacement or repairs not only avert unexpected failures but also provide peace of mind that your building remains secure.
Addressing Weather-Related Roof Damage
Weather-related damage is also a compelling reason to hire a roofing contractor. Severe weather conditions such as storms, hail, strong winds, or heavy snowfall can cause immediate and extensive harm to a commercial roof. While some damage may be obvious, such as missing materials or punctures, other issues like loosened seams or hidden water intrusion may not be visible to the untrained eye. In the aftermath of such events, having a professional evaluate the roof can identify these less apparent problems before they escalate into major concerns. Their expertise is critical in diagnosing and addressing issues promptly, helping you avoid costly repairs down the road.
Staying on Top of Regular Maintenance Needs
Regular maintenance needs present another scenario where the expertise of a commercial roofing contractor is invaluable. Routine inspections and scheduled upkeep can extend the life of your roof considerably by catching small issues, such as clogged drains, loose fasteners, or damaged membranes, before they become significant problems. Neglecting these seemingly minor concerns often leads to costly emergency repairs or premature roof replacement. Professional contractors not only have the tools and knowledge to perform maintenance effectively but can also provide documentation of the roof's condition, which is useful for warranties and insurance claims.
Exploring Roofing Upgrades and Material Changes
Finally, if you're considering an upgrade or a change in roofing materials, it is advisable to consult with a roofing contractor. Modern advancements in roofing technology have introduced materials that are more energy-efficient, environmentally friendly, and durable than traditional options. Whether you're looking to reduce utility costs with reflective materials, enhance the aesthetic value of your property, or switch to a roof system that better withstands your region's climate, a contractor can provide valuable insights and recommendations. They have the experience to evaluate different materials' suitability for your building and goals, as well as help you navigate costs, warranties, and maintenance requirements.
